Tokyopop acquired the licensing rights to distribute the manga in English and released the first five volumes before the company shut down its North American publishing division in 2011.
A 12-episode anime television series adaptation produced by Manglobe aired between April and July 2011, pulling content from the first 21 chapters of the manga.
A massive anomaly caused a great earthquake that ravaged Japan's mainland and destroyed most of Tokyo, sinking three-quarters of the city into the Pacific Ocean.
Ten years later, Ganta Igarashi is a seemingly ordinary ninth grader attending Nagano Prefecture's middle school who survived the great earthquake, leaving him with a normal life and no memories of the tragedy.
This all changes when a mysterious person covered in blood and crimson armor floats through his classroom windows and massacres his entire class, but spares Ganta and embeds a red crystal shard into his chest.

After discovering his ability, Ganta is forced to participate in brutal gladiatorial death matches known as Carnival Corpse, whose anonymous spectators pay large amounts of money to watch.
In his long struggle to survive, he manages to befriend some of those he fought in the arena and with their help, Ganta continues his quest to uncover the identity of the 'Red Man', why he turned into a Deadman, and the dark secrets the prison authorities are hiding.
